FIREARMS PUSH: India Orders more than 16,000 Israeli Negev Light Machineguns

March 19, 2020 - In the latest in a slew of infantry firearms purchases for the Indian Army, the Indian MoD today signed a $118 million deal with Israel Weapon Industries (IWI) for 16,479 NEGEV NG7 7.62mm light machineguns (LMG).

The order is a little less than half of a total requirement for 40,000 LMGs.

Today’s order is the single largest order for LMGs, and adds to smaller numbers of Negev 7.62x51mm LMGs already in service. The NG7 was introduced in 2012.
